Frequently Asked Questions

How much does tree felling cost in Sandhurst?
Costs vary widely based on tree size, location, access, and whether stump grinding is included. Local Tree Surgeons typically quote £300–£2,000 per tree. Request itemised quotes for comparison.
Is my tree surgeon in Sandhurst properly qualified?
Look for NPTC Level 3 credentials, Lantra certification, and evidence of public liability insurance. Qualified Tree Surgeons operate to BS 3998 standards and may hold Arboricultural Association membership.
How quickly can a tree surgeon in Sandhurst respond to storm damage?
Many local Tree Surgeons offer emergency call-outs within 24–48 hours following storms. Contact several contractors immediately—response times vary depending on demand and crew availability.
